Percutaneous Approach to Gynecologic Surgery
Laparoscopic gynecologic surgery has emerged as a preferred modality for treating a wide range of conditions. This technique involves making small in the abdomen to visualize and manipulate internal organs with the aid of a laparoscope, a flexible telescope connected to a high-definition monitor. Against open surgery, laparoscopy offers numerous benefits, including smaller scars, lessened pain, shorter hospital stays, and faster return to normal activities.
- Typical laparoscopic gynecologic procedures include hysterectomies, oophorectomies, salpingectomies, myomectomies, and endometriosis treatment.
- The proficiency of the surgeon is crucial for successfully performing laparoscopic surgery.
- Patient selection for laparoscopy depends on factors such as the nature and severity of the condition, overall health status, and individual circumstances.
Role for Imaging in Diagnosing Uterine Pathology
Imaging plays a crucial role in the accurate diagnosis of uterine pathology.
Modalities such as ultrasound, MRI, and CT scans provide valuable insights into the structure and function of the uterus. These diagnostic modalities allow physicians to detect abnormalities, like fibroids, polyps, cysts, and endometrial hyperplasia. Ultrasound is a frequently used first-line imaging technique due to its non-invasive nature, affordability, and ability to provide real-time images. MRI offers superior anatomical detail and can differentiate between various types of uterine pathology. CT scans are primarily used for detecting complications or assessing the spread of disease. Through careful interpretation of imaging findings, physicians can make a diagnosis and guide appropriate treatment plans.
